1368 makes a splash Kayaking on the Leam

Cadets from 1368 Squadron recently had some fun on the River Leam where we learnt that staff are less chicken when it comes to falling backwards SAS - Who Dares Wins style, and has some fun on the seal launch.




We also learnt that Cdt P is attracted by different gravitation forces. Adventure training is one of the core activities in the RAF Air Cadets. It helps build self-esteem, team work and comradery. At 1368, we like to get involved in kayaking, climbing and other outdoor pursuits.
